Jurgen Klopp rules himself OUT of running for Manchester United job

David Moyes' 295-day reign at Old Trafford was ended by club officials early on Tuesday after an underwhelming 10 months in charge.

Jurgen Klopp

Klopp, who guided Borussia Dortmund to consecutive Bundesliga titles as well as a Champions League final in 2013, was seen by many as a clear front runner to succeed the Scot in charge of last season's deposed champions.

But it appears the charismatic German has now reaffirmed his desire to stay at Signal Iduna Park.

"Man Utd is a great club and I feel very familiar with their wonderful fans," Klopp told the Guardian. "But my commitment to Borussia Dortmund and the people is not breakable."
